Personal Income Tax (PIT) in Vietnam | Update 2026
Personal Income Tax (PIT) is withheld from the income earned by the employee in Vietnam from providing works under labor contract or agreement.
PIT is calculated on accessible income with progressive rate from 5% to 35% or by flat rate at 10%, depending on each type of employment.
For non-tax resident, flat rate 20% is applicable on all sources of income without deduction.
[Assessable Income = Taxable Income – Deductible Items]DEDUCTIBLE ITEMS
▪️ Personal relief VND11 million per month (equal to VND 132 million per annum)
▪️ Dependent relief VND4.4 million per registered dependent
▪️ Monthly SHUI contribution (For more details, please visit https://lnkd.in/eNDt9HDg)
▪️ Other deduction following prevailing tax regulations
🌟 UPDATE FOR THE TAX PERIOD 2026
Personal relief | VND15.5 million per month
Dependent relief | VND6.2 million per month
PIT FILINGS
▪️ PIT return is declared on monthly or quarterly basis together with payment.
▪️ PIT finalization is required to undertake at calendar year-ending i.e. by 31 Mar annually.
